About the Business

America's Thrift Stores

America's Thrift Stores, located at 431 Hwy 280 Bypass in Phenix City, Alabama, is a store that makes donating easy and convenient. If you have more than two bags of donations in good condition, they even offer a free home pickup service in cities where their stores are located. Every donation made to America's Thrift Stores helps support their six charity partners, who work to improve the lives of children with critical illnesses and those affected by addiction. They accept a variety of items including clothing, toys, furniture, and household goods. You can also drop off donations at their store locations. Some of the charity partners they support include Make-A-Wish Alabama, Children's Healthcare of Atlanta, and Adult & Teen Challenge.
